基于深度学习CNN算法的植物/中草药分类识别系统01--带数据集-pyqt5UI界面-全套源码
基于深度学习算法的植物/中草药识别系统-全套代码数据集-保姆级教程
探索数据结构:深入了解顺序表的奥秘
顺序表是一种经典的数据结构,它以连续的存储空间存储元素,提供快速的随机访问能力。本文将深入探讨顺序表的原理、特点以及常见操作,帮助读者全面了解顺序表的内部机理和优劣势。无论您是初学者还是资深开发者,对于数据结构的理解都至关重要。通过本文的解读,相信您将对顺序表有更深入的认识,并能够更好地运用它来解决
数据结构-单链表
概念:链表是一种物理存储结构上非连续、非顺序的存储结构,数据元素的逻辑顺序是通过链表中的指针链接次序实现的。从以上图片可以看出:1.链式结构在逻辑上是连续的,但在物理上不一定是连续的。2.现实中的节点一般是在堆上申请出来的。3.从堆上申请的空间,是按照一定的策略来分配的,两次申请的空间可能连续,可能
算法(2)——滑动窗口
滑动窗口OJ题目详解
MATLAB实现光谱寻峰算法完整教程
本文还有配套的精品资源,点击获取 简介:本压缩包包含了MATLAB编写的光谱寻峰算法源码,适用于科学数据分析,特别是在光学、化学、物理学等领域。光谱寻峰算法涉及数据预处理、噪声过滤、峰值检测、参数优化等关键步骤。通过学习该教程,读者将掌握如何利用MATLAB处理光谱数据,包括平滑滤波、噪声过滤、
力扣动态规划基础版(矩阵型)
矩阵相关的动态规划题目,深入理解
【LeetCode刷题日志】138.随机链表的复制
当我们完成了拷贝节点的随机指针的赋值,我们只需要将这个链表按照原节点与拷贝节点的种类进行拆分即可,只需要遍历一次。这样,我们可以直接找到每一个拷贝节点S′的随机指针应当指向的节点,即为其原节点S的随机指针指向的节点T的后继节点T′。我们首先将该链表中每一个节点拆分为两个相连的节点,例如对于链表A→B
【数据结构】——二叉树的递归实现,看完不再害怕递归
递归无非就是相信它,只有你相信它,你才能写好递归!为什么?请往下看
Latex写算法的伪代码排版
algorithm2e包可能会与其它包产生冲突,一个常见的错误提示是“Too many }'...”。
[数据结构 - C++] 红黑树RBTree
红黑树的模拟实现详解
数据结构——lesson10排序之插入排序
元素集合越接近有序,直接插入排序算法的时间效率越高时间复杂度:O(N^2)从下标为1开始每次拿出数组的一位数与前面的数进行比较,按照最坏的情况前面所有的数都比较一次,时间复杂度可以看成1+2+3+4+…+n-1;结果是O(N^2);如果元素集合接近有序则不需要和前面所有的数比较时间复杂度大大减少,最
回溯算法--01背包问题
回溯算法是一种解决问题的通用算法,能够在一个问题的所有解空间中,按深度优先的策略搜索,直到找到所需要的解或者搜索完整个解空间都没有找到解。0-1背包问题是指在限制背包容量的情况下,在一堆物品中选择一部分,使得这些物品的总价值最大。C++ 设计回溯算法解决0-1 背包问题的思路。
【通俗易懂】计算机术语中trivial和non-trivial是什么意思
计算机科学的术语中,non-trivial是“非平凡”,用来形容任何有意义的、非零的参数或者因子。trivial是“平凡的”,在计算机科学中,通常用来形容那些没有实际意义或非常容易实现的参数或者因子。
【算法专题】贪心算法
算法专题之贪心算法
冒泡排序、选择排序、计数排序、插入排序、快速排序、堆排序、归并排序JAVA实现
冒泡排序、选择排序、计数排序、插入排序、快速排序、堆排序、归并排序JAVA实现。
算法——BP神经网络
BP神经网络(Backpropagation Neural Network),也称为反向传播神经网络,是一种最常见和广泛应用的前馈型人工神经网络模型。BP神经网络由多个层次组成,包括输入层、隐藏层和输出层。每个层级都由多个神经元构成,它们通过带有权重的连接相互连接。信息在网络中从输入层向前传递,通过
【面试必备】八大排序 (上)通俗易懂(配源码和实操图)
本章是复习篇:基础的排序是我们面试的必不可少的一块本章首先先对排序有一定的了解,然后再从简单基础的插入排序、以及一个交换排序的冒泡排序开始学习,后面还将继续更新更多的排序算法,敬请期待!
算法【Java】—— 动态规划之简单多状态 dp 问题
算法【Java】—— 动态规划之简单多状态 dp 问题
数据结构:图文详解 队列 | 循环队列 的各种操作(出队,入队,获取队列元素,判断队列状态)
队列(Queue)是一种数据结构,是一种先进先出(First-In-First-Out,FIFO)的线性数据结构。它只允许在列表的一端进行插入操作(入队),在另一端进行删除操作(出队),即队头进行删除操作,队尾进行插入操作。队列常用的操作有入队(Enqueue)、出队(Dequeue)、获取队头元素
【动态规划】【map】【C++算法】1289. 下降路径最小和 II
给你一个 n x n 整数矩阵 grid ,请你返回 非零偏移下降路径 数字和的最小值。非零偏移下降路径 定义为:从 grid 数组中的每一行选择一个数字,且按顺序选出来的数字中,相邻数字不在原数组的同一列。